Reviewed the proposed joint venture with Aldervane Metals covering the Torbay coatings facility. Capital commitment is manageable; payback modeled at 3.1 years under base case. Governance split 55/45 in our favor. Key risks: Aldervane's leverage and untested demand in the Quilport corridor. Diligence flagged no material issues. Recommendation: proceed to term sheet, subject to board sign-off next cycle. Finance team should hold all forecasts pending the strategic note appended directly below this summary.

board note of kagep-yahig: Only 9 of the 120 pilot accounts renewed Quenix, so a churn review is set for April 1.

TURN-208: Gatevale turnstile counters at the Merrow Field pilot double-count when a rotation reverses mid-cycle. Attendance totals drift roughly 2% high per event. The debounce window fix is implemented, reviewed by Ilsa, and soak-tested across two simulated match days without drift. Ready for your cut; the candidate build is identified below.

trace token, tagag-tafog: htk6_5ed18c

## v3.2.0 — Changed defaults (InkSlip PDF renderer)

Heads up for the security review: InkSlip now disables embedded JavaScript in generated invoices by default, and external font fetching is off unless explicitly re-enabled. We also shortened the temp-file lifetime from 24h to 1h. Nobody on the Bramleigh team has needed the old behavior, so we're not keeping a legacy flag. The new default configuration ships as follows.

settings of tagef-bawif:
DRUIX_HOST=druix.zemvarlabs.internal
DRUIX_PORT=8000

Quick rundown for branch managers ahead of the leadership review. The proposed franchise agreement with Dunmore Restaurant Partners covers twelve locations across the Casterbay region over three years. Terms look solid: standard royalty, shared marketing fund, and a training commitment at our Fernhollow academy. The sticking point is menu flexibility — Dunmore wants regional items, and we're inclined to allow a capped percentage. Expect questions on quality control and supply routing. The confidential note on business plans follows below.

management briefing: Project Ulavan slips by two quarters because of the staffing delay.